Background
Cytokine that in its homotrimeric form binds to TNFRSF1A, TNFR1, TNFRSF1B, TNFBR and TNFRSF14, HVEM. In its heterotrimeric form with LTB binds to TNFRSF3, LTBR. Lymphotoxin is produced by lymphocytes and cytotoxic for a wide range of tumor cells in vitro and in vivo.
